Jingle With my Princess
By Mona Risk

Talk about instant attraction! Wow! I loved how open Charlene is…not afraid to shower him with affection. Very nice! Problem is she live most of her life across the pond. He in the US. How can they come together?
Scott has been burned before by a princess but there is just something about Princess Charlene that he can’t resist. Too bad he brought his current lover along on the business trip. Not only that but he is there to help his ex-fiancé and her husband (a Prince) who stole her from him. Now what to do? Can he put his feelings aside for his Ex? Can he move forward?

Finding Love on Christmas Vacation by Stacy Eaton is the story of Lucy, which spends every Christmas with her father, Charlie, at his cabin. This year she will spend it without her father, since is has passed away and she will be spreading his ashes on the lake as per his final request. Her father always spoke of a friend that always stayed in the neighboring cabin, his name is Maverick. Have you ever fallen in love with someone before you meet them? Maverick did,he was in love with Lucy by the stories and pictures her father always shared with Maverick through the years. He finally has his chance to meet her and the connection is instant between the two. This is a quick, holiday romance that you will truly enjoy the same way I did.

A Christmas Creek Carol by Rachelle Ayala is the story of Ebony and Blaze. Ebony is a writer that is back in Christmas Creek for the holidays to write her next story. Blaze is in the military and visiting his father for the holiday but also to see Ebony. Blaze will go to any lengths to make Ebony realize that they are meant to be together. Will Ebony finish writing her story and will Blaze finally be with Ebony? You will have to read to find out.

A Christmas Getaway by Jen Talty is the story about Olivia and Ryder. Olivia always takes her son Noah away for the holidays, since his dad was a Navy Pilot that was killed before he was born. Ryder is a Navy Seal that has book a cabin at a resort for the holidays. What are the odds that two people can book the same cabin at the same time? Well it happens to Olivia and Ryder and this is how the two meet. Ryder, like Olivia & Noah, has suffered an immense loss when his wife and sons were murdered the day after Christmas. Both have shared loss and they both can help each other through the pain of loss of your significant other. This story completely gutted me but also made me smile on how these two strangers can fall in love in the midst of pain.
